%changelog
* Fri Apr 22 2011 Jens Petersen <petersen@redhat.com> - 0.9.2-6
- drop explicit requires on ghc-xmonad-devel for lighter installs
- update readme to mention gsettings for gnome3
- enable ppc64 build
* Fri Apr 1 2011 Jens Petersen <petersen@redhat.com> - 0.9.2-5
- use desktop-file-install to install xmonad.desktop correctly
- really disable hscolour not haddock
- update the desktop files for desktop-file-validate
* Fri Mar 11 2011 Jens Petersen <petersen@redhat.com> - 0.9.2-4
- disable hscolour for now to build
- disable haddock for now to build
* Thu Mar 10 2011 Fabio M. Di Nitto <fdinitto@redhat.com> - 0.9.2-3
- Enable build on sparcv9
